
Cordova serves as the focal point of this coastal survey, situated at the edge of Orca Inlet where the waters of Prince William Sound meet the foot of the Heney Range. The landscape is dominated by the transition from deep water channels like Odiak Channel and Orca Channel to the towering peaks of Mt Eyak and Snyder Mtn. The presence of a Cem and a Cannery at Shepard Pt illustrates the early industrial and social foundations of this Alaskan port.
